Clarkson’s Farm Season 3 release date

Season 3 will start streaming on Friday, 3 May and will be released in two parts. The show then returns for Part 2 next Friday, 10 May.

Just like Clarkson’s Farm Season 2 and 1, the third season will also consist of eight episodes.

What is the premise of Clarkson’s Farm?

Clarkson’s Farm is a Cotswolds-based television documentary series about Jeremy Clarkson and his rural farm. The farm was once part of the Oxfordshire estate of Sarsden. In 2008, Jeremy Clarkson purchased a thousand acres, including Curdle Hill Farm.

Jeremy Clarkson’s farm begins with the man mocking himself — he buys the incorrect tractor and believes he knows more about the profession than everybody else. But the tone quickly shifts and as Clarkson realises just how difficult it is.

In a nutshell, the show is all about the intense, backbreaking, and frequently hilarious year in the life of Britain’s most unlikely farmer. Clarkson and his agricultural associates of farmhands confront the worst farming weather in decades, disobedient animals, unresponsive crops, and a whole lot of nasty difficulties.

Jeremy Clarkson must start from square one, buying his first tractor and other farm equipment. Then he needs to get the farm animals on board; without them no rural farm is complete. As he stumbles from one adventure to another misadventure, Clarkson must reconnect with his farming instinct and draw upon the experience of a common past. 

In Clarkson’s Farm Season 3, Diddly Squat is in serious trouble. A closure notice, failing crops due to stifling heat, and inflation are just some of the major issues that are threatening the farm’s future. The restaurant business in the farm was also discontinued.

While things are going downhill, Jeremy is not one to give up. He knows he has to figure out something worthwhile to keep things in the farm afloat and he needs to do it fast. With hundreds of acres of unfarmed land that makes up half of Diddly Squat, there’s a potential for profit. Will his newly hatched plans turn things around?
